How they compare

Antigua and Barbuda currently reports 12.11 million US dollar against 12.02 million US dollar in Sint Maarten (Dutch part), a difference of 90,500 US dollar.

Across all 9 years both countries report, Sint Maarten (Dutch part) has been ahead every year.

Antigua and Barbuda ranks 136th and Sint Maarten (Dutch part) ranks 137th of 158 countries.

Sint Maarten (Dutch part) has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

The International Investment Position (IIP) is a statistical statement that shows at a point in time the value of financial assets of residents of an economy that are claims on nonresidents or are gold bullion held as reserve assets; and the liabilities of residents of an economy to nonresidents.
